Check the wiring to the compressor, it may have been setup to bypass the pressure switch which would cause it to run all the time.
If you disconnect the wire and it's still spinning then the shaft may be bent which I've seen to cause this kind of thing.
You know when the compressor is running because the front of the compressor is turning.

Good news is that you can get rebuilt A6 compressors for about $120.
